Transaction 08e74391f2f0fee312eb52e85192492b8dfa566fc4a080dffb7632dc260ed254

2 Input
1 Outputs
  • 08e74391f2f0fee312eb52e85192492b8dfa566fc4a080dffb7632dc260ed254:0
  • value  46981043
    address  bc1q0cz8mhxnupxpuggzsnwj7m2rng684wwfwt4rc5